Athlete of the Week – Girl’s Cross Country – Amelia Allender, Junior This week’s Athlete of the Week is junior Amelia Allender, who has established herself as one of the leaders of the Mooresville Girls Cross Country team through her consistency, work ethic, and continued improvement throughout the early part of the season. Amelia opened the year as one of the Pioneers’ top runners, setting a personal record at the LaVern Gibson Championship Cross Country Course. She followed that performance with another strong race at Plainfield, where she and teammate Carlee McIntosh were the first Pioneers to cross the finish line. Since then, Amelia has continued to build on that strong start. Meet after meet, she has continued to improve her times and establish new personal bests, showing that the work she is putting in during the week is translating directly to her performances on race day. Her steady progression has made her an important part of the Pioneers’ lineup. What makes Amelia’s success even more impressive is the commitment required to make it happen. Because of her Area 31 class schedule, her practice routine looks different from many of her teammates. Rather than allowing that to become an obstacle, Amelia consistently puts in the extra effort necessary to complete her training and continue improving. Amelia’s approach is a great example of leadership through actions. She has shown a willingness to put in the work, adapt when necessary, and continue challenging herself to get better each time she competes. For her continued improvement, consistent performances, and outstanding work ethic, Amelia Allender is a well-deserving Athlete of the Week. Athlete of the Week – Boy’s Soccer – Dakota Strachan, Senior This week’s Athlete of the Week is senior captain Dakota Strachan, whose performance, work ethic, and leadership continue to make an impact for the Mooresville Boys Soccer team. Dakota highlighted his week with a strong offensive performance against Plainfield, scoring both of the Pioneers’ goals. His ability to step up and find the back of the net provided an important spark for his team and demonstrated the competitiveness he brings every time he takes the field. While his two-goal performance stood out on the stat sheet, Dakota’s impact on the Pioneers goes well beyond scoring. As a team captain, he leads by example through his effort and preparation. He consistently works hard and challenges his teammates to raise their level of play each day. Dakota also brings the energy and enthusiasm his team needs throughout a long season. Whether things are going well or the Pioneers are facing adversity, he works to keep his teammates motivated, encourages them to keep their heads up, and looks for any way he can contribute to the team's success. With this being his final season in a Pioneer uniform, Dakota is determined to make the most of every opportunity. He has brought a noticeable fire and drive to his senior year and continues to set an example for those around him. For his two-goal performance against Plainfield and the leadership, energy, and work ethic he brings to the program every day, Dakota Strachan is a well-deserving Athlete of the Week.
